The changes to the R&D tax incentive announced in the October 2020 budget have been passed as law, but do not become effective until 1 July 2021 (FY22). Companies registering activity for the financial year about to end (FY21) will do so under the same legislation in place as in prior years. Companies seeking to register R&D Activities conducted during the Year Ended 30 June 2020 (ie FY20 – last financial year) who are yet to do so should note that the Registration Deadline is 30 April 2021. Last year, AusIndustry applied a blanket extension to all companies’ FY19 R&D Applications due to COVID. AusIndustry and the ATO have published a joint podcast on business.gov.au this week, featuring Brett Challans (ATO) and Kelly Wiggins (DISER). The podcast discusses key R&D Tax Incentive issues relevant to each department, including: Eligible entities; The self-assessment process; Categories of ineligible expenditure; Records relevant to substantiating the R&D process through systematic progression of work i.e. from hypothesis to conclusions.
